Water pressure repair services address issues related to inconsistent or insufficient water flow within a plumbing system. These services typically involve diagnosing the root causes of pressure problems, which can include faulty pressure regulators, blocked pipes, or leaks that reduce overall water flow. Once the problem is identified, technicians may replace or repair damaged components, clear obstructions, or adjust pressure regulators to restore proper water pressure levels throughout the property. Ensuring optimal water pressure helps improve the functionality of fixtures and appliances, providing a more reliable water supply.
Problems that water pressure repair services help resolve often include low water flow, fluctuating pressure, or sudden drops in pressure that can disrupt daily routines. Insufficient water pressure can cause difficulties in operating showers, faucets, or appliances like dishwashers and washing machines. Conversely, excessively high water pressure can lead to pipe damage, leaks, or even burst pipes, posing risks to the property’s plumbing infrastructure. Repair services aim to correct these issues, preventing potential water damage and ensuring consistent, safe water delivery across the property.

Repair Costs - Water pressure repair services typically range from $150 to $600, depending on the severity of the issue. For example, minor repairs may cost around $150, while more extensive fixes could reach $600 or more.
Service Call Fees - Many service providers charge a diagnostic fee that can vary between $50 and $150. This fee is often applied toward the total cost if repairs are authorized.
Replacement Parts - Replacing faulty pressure regulators or valves usually costs between $100 and $300, with prices depending on the specific part needed and its complexity.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for water pressure repairs generally range from $75 to $200 per hour, with total costs influenced by the project's complexity and time required.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es low water pressure in a home? Low water pressure can result from issues such as clogged pipes, leaks, or problems with the main water supply. Local water pressure repair services can diagnose and address these causes.
How can water pressure be safely increased? Professionals may recommend pipe cleaning, fixing leaks, or installing pressure regulators to safely improve water pressure levels.
What are common signs of water pressure problems? Signs include inconsistent flow, reduced water volume, or noticeable drops in pressure during use. Local service providers can assess and resolve these issues.
